:root{--cyan:#00E5FF;--cyan-50:rgba(0,229,255,0.5);--cyan-15:rgba(0,229,255,0.15);--cyan-08:rgba(0,229,255,0.08);--cyan-04:rgba(0,229,255,0.04);--bg-0:#04070D;--bg-1:#080D18;--bg-2:#0C1220;--bg-3:#111828;--bg-4:#161E32;--tx-0:#EEF1F8;--tx-1:#B4BDD4;--tx-2:#7280A0;--tx-3:#424F6E;--tx-4:#2A3452;--bdr:rgba(255,255,255,0.05);--bdr-m:rgba(255,255,255,0.08);--bdr-h:rgba(255,255,255,0.14);--font-display:"Playfair Display",serif;--font-body:"Source Sans 3",sans-serif;--font-mono:"Fira Code",monospace;--rail-w:52px;--radius:2px;--radius-sm:0px;--signet-dark:var(--bg-0);--bg-deep:var(--bg-0);--bg-surface:var(--bg-1);--glass:var(--bg-2);--glass-border:var(--bdr-m);--glass-hover:var(--bg-4);--text-primary:var(--tx-0);--text-secondary:var(--tx-1);--text-tertiary:var(--tx-2);--signet-blue:var(--cyan);--deep-blue:var(--cyan);--light-blue:var(--cyan);--silver:var(--tx-2);--cyan-deep:var(--cyan);--cyan-light:var(--cyan);--gradient-brand:var(--cyan);--gradient-system:var(--cyan);--gradient-brand-subtle:var(--cyan-08);--gradient-system-subtle:var(--cyan-08);--glow-brand:0 0 20px rgba(0,229,255,0.12)}*,:after,:before{margin:0;padding:0;box-sizing:border-box}html{scroll-behavior:smooth}body{font-family:var(--font-body);font-size:17px;line-height:1.65;background:var(--bg-0);color:var(--tx-0);overflow-x:hidden;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{color:inherit;text-decoration:none}img{max-width:100%;height:auto}.main-content{margin-left:var(--rail-w)}.container{position:relative;z-index:2;max-width:1200px;margin:0 auto;padding:0 48px}.container-narrow{max-width:720px;margin:0 auto;padding:0 48px}section{padding:88px 48px;position:relative;z-index:1}.sec-a{background:var(--bg-1)}.sec-b{background:var(--bg-0)}.ey,.section-label{font-family:var(--font-mono);font-size:11px;font-weight:600;letter-spacing:3px;text-transform:uppercase;color:var(--cyan);margin-bottom:14px}.section-heading,.ttl{font-family:var(--font-display);font-size:clamp(30px,3.5vw,48px);font-weight:800;line-height:1.08;letter-spacing:-1.2px;margin-bottom:14px}.dsc,.section-sub{font-size:17px;color:var(--tx-1);max-width:520px;line-height:1.75;margin-bottom:56px}.gradient-text-brand,.gradient-text-system{color:var(--tx-0)}.btn-cy,.btn-primary{font-family:var(--font-body);font-size:14px;font-weight:700;background:var(--cyan);color:var(--bg-0);padding:13px 28px;border:none;cursor:pointer;text-decoration:none;display:inline-flex;align-items:center;gap:8px;border-radius:2px;transition:all .2s;box-shadow:0 0 20px rgba(0,229,255,.12);letter-spacing:0}.btn-cy:hover,.btn-primary:hover:not(:disabled){background:#33EBFF;box-shadow:0 0 28px rgba(0,229,255,.2);transform:none}.btn-primary:disabled{opacity:.5;cursor:not-allowed}.btn-out,.btn-secondary{font-family:var(--font-body);font-size:14px;font-weight:600;background:transparent;color:var(--tx-0);padding:13px 28px;border:1px solid var(--bdr-h);cursor:pointer;text-decoration:none;display:inline-block;border-radius:2px;transition:all .2s}.btn-out:hover,.btn-secondary:hover{border-color:var(--tx-2);background:transparent}.btn-cy-arrow{display:inline-block;width:0;height:0;border-left:5px solid var(--bg-0);border-top:3px solid transparent;border-bottom:3px solid transparent}@keyframes fi{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}.fi{opacity:0;transform:translateY(14px);animation:fi .55s ease forwards}.d1{animation-delay:.08s}.d2{animation-delay:.16s}.d3{animation-delay:.24s}.d4{animation-delay:.38s}@keyframes fadeUp{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}@keyframes pulse{0%,to{opacity:1;box-shadow:0 0 0 0 rgba(0,229,255,.4)}50%{opacity:.7;box-shadow:0 0 0 6px rgba(0,229,255,0)}}@media (max-width:1024px){.main-content{margin-left:0}section{padding:64px 24px}.container,.container-narrow{padding:0 24px}}.Footer_footer__pQtti{background:var(--bg-0);border-top:1px solid var(--bdr);position:relative;z-index:1}.Footer_newsletterRow__NvTia{padding:24px 48px}.Footer_newsletterRow__NvTia,.Footer_resourceRow__H_SZw{max-width:1200px;margin:0 auto;border-bottom:1px solid var(--bdr)}.Footer_resourceRow__H_SZw{padding:20px 48px;display:flex;align-items:center;gap:20px}.Footer_resourceLabel__Dq62d{font-family:var(--font-mono);font-size:10px;font-weight:600;letter-spacing:1.5px;text-transform:uppercase;color:var(--tx-3);white-space:nowrap}.Footer_resourceLinks__1TQOg{display:flex;flex-wrap:wrap;gap:20px}.Footer_resourceLinks__1TQOg a{font-family:var(--font-mono);font-size:11px;color:var(--tx-4);text-decoration:none;letter-spacing:.5px;transition:color .2s}.Footer_resourceLinks__1TQOg a:hover{color:var(--tx-1)}.Footer_main__mKsyE{max-width:1200px;margin:0 auto;padding:28px 48px;display:grid;grid-template-columns:1fr auto;align-items:center}.Footer_copyright__j4atB{font-family:var(--font-mono);font-size:11px;color:var(--tx-4);letter-spacing:.5px}.Footer_links__cFiYr{display:flex;gap:20px}.Footer_links__cFiYr a{font-family:var(--font-mono);font-size:11px;color:var(--tx-4);text-decoration:none;letter-spacing:.5px;transition:color .2s}.Footer_links__cFiYr a:hover{color:var(--tx-1)}.Footer_creditRow__JsJle{max-width:1200px;margin:0 auto;padding:16px 48px 20px;border-top:1px solid var(--bdr);font-family:var(--font-mono);font-size:10px;color:var(--tx-4);text-align:center;letter-spacing:.3px}.Footer_creditRow__JsJle a{color:var(--tx-4);text-decoration:none;transition:color .2s}.Footer_creditRow__JsJle a:hover{color:var(--cyan)}@media (max-width:1024px){.Footer_creditRow__JsJle,.Footer_main__mKsyE,.Footer_newsletterRow__NvTia,.Footer_resourceRow__H_SZw{padding-left:24px;padding-right:24px}.Footer_resourceRow__H_SZw{flex-direction:column;gap:12px;text-align:center}.Footer_resourceLinks__1TQOg{justify-content:center}.Footer_main__mKsyE{grid-template-columns:1fr;text-align:center;gap:16px}.Footer_links__cFiYr{justify-content:center;flex-wrap:wrap}}.Nav_nav__o8sSc{position:fixed;top:0;left:var(--rail-w);right:0;z-index:100;display:flex;align-items:center;justify-content:space-between;padding:0 48px;height:56px;background:transparent;border-bottom:none;overflow:visible}.Nav_logo__98dCe{display:flex;align-items:center;text-decoration:none;flex-shrink:0;align-self:flex-start}.Nav_logo__98dCe img{display:block;height:96px;width:96px;object-fit:contain;filter:drop-shadow(0 0 12px rgba(0,229,255,.35)) drop-shadow(0 0 28px rgba(0,229,255,.15))}.Nav_links__8Axcs{display:flex;gap:0;align-items:center}.Nav_link__AQMuy{font-family:var(--font-mono);font-size:11.5px;font-weight:700;text-decoration:none;padding:8px 16px;letter-spacing:.8px;text-transform:uppercase;transition:color .2s}.Nav_link__AQMuy,.Nav_link__AQMuy:hover{color:var(--tx-0)}.Nav_cta__gBZXl{margin-left:8px;background:var(--cyan);color:var(--bg-0)!important;font-family:var(--font-mono);font-size:11.5px;font-weight:600;padding:7px 18px;border-radius:2px;text-decoration:none;text-transform:uppercase;letter-spacing:.8px;transition:background .2s}.Nav_cta__gBZXl:hover{background:#33EBFF}.Nav_dropdownParent__uAxvZ{position:relative}.Nav_dropdownToggle__noGAe{background:none;border:none;font-family:var(--font-mono);font-size:11.5px;font-weight:700;color:var(--tx-0);padding:8px 16px;letter-spacing:.8px;text-transform:uppercase;cursor:pointer;transition:color .2s}.Nav_dropdownToggle__noGAe:hover{color:var(--tx-0)}.Nav_dropdown__a1fJY{display:none;position:absolute;top:calc(100% + 12px);left:50%;transform:translateX(-50%);min-width:160px;background:var(--bg-3);border:1px solid var(--bdr-m);padding:6px;flex-direction:column;z-index:200}.Nav_dropdown__a1fJY:before{content:"";position:absolute;top:-12px;left:0;right:0;height:12px}.Nav_dropdownParent__uAxvZ:hover .Nav_dropdown__a1fJY{display:flex}.Nav_dropdownLink__rLOoi{display:block;padding:7px 12px;font-family:var(--font-mono);font-size:11px;color:var(--tx-2);text-decoration:none;letter-spacing:.5px;transition:background .15s,color .15s}.Nav_dropdownLink__rLOoi:hover{background:var(--bg-4);color:var(--tx-0)}.Nav_mobileRight__JUB8_{display:none}.Nav_menuToggle__a5VSy{display:flex;flex-direction:column;gap:5px;background:none;border:none;cursor:pointer;padding:4px}.Nav_menuToggle__a5VSy span{display:block;width:20px;height:2px;background:var(--tx-0)}.Nav_mobileMenu__3qPm8{display:none}.Nav_mobileLink__IMD5_{display:block;padding:10px 0;font-family:var(--font-mono);font-size:12px;font-weight:700;color:var(--tx-0);text-decoration:none;text-transform:uppercase;letter-spacing:.8px}.Nav_mobileLink__IMD5_:hover{color:var(--tx-0)}.Nav_mobileDropToggle__S81vL{background:none;border:none;display:block;padding:10px 0;font-family:var(--font-mono);font-size:12px;font-weight:700;color:var(--tx-0);text-transform:uppercase;letter-spacing:.8px;cursor:pointer}.Nav_mobileDropContent__F9V5Z{padding-left:16px}.Nav_mobileCta__jAgsX{display:inline-block;margin-top:12px;background:var(--cyan);color:var(--bg-0);font-family:var(--font-mono);font-size:12px;font-weight:600;padding:8px 20px;border-radius:2px;text-decoration:none;text-transform:uppercase;letter-spacing:.8px}@media (max-width:1024px){.Nav_nav__o8sSc{left:0;padding:0 24px}.Nav_links__8Axcs{display:none}.Nav_mobileRight__JUB8_{display:block}.Nav_mobileMenu__3qPm8{display:block;position:absolute;top:56px;left:0;right:0;background:rgba(4,7,13,.95);backdrop-filter:blur(16px);-webkit-backdrop-filter:blur(16px);border-bottom:1px solid var(--bdr);padding:16px 24px}}.NewsletterForm_input__kbLPR{padding:12px 20px;font-family:var(--font-body);font-size:15px;color:var(--text-primary);background:var(--bg-2);border:1px solid var(--bdr-m);border-radius:0;outline:none;transition:border-color .25s ease}.NewsletterForm_input__kbLPR::placeholder{color:var(--text-tertiary)}.NewsletterForm_input__kbLPR:focus{border-color:var(--cyan)}.NewsletterForm_btn__Mfimy{padding:12px 24px;font-family:var(--font-body);font-size:15px;font-weight:600;color:var(--bg-deep);background:var(--cyan);border:none;border-radius:0;cursor:pointer;white-space:nowrap;transition:background .2s ease}.NewsletterForm_btn__Mfimy:hover{background:var(--cyan-light)}.NewsletterForm_inlineForm__C89SW{display:flex;align-items:center;gap:16px;flex-wrap:wrap}.NewsletterForm_inlineLabel__fpGfa{font-size:15px;color:var(--text-secondary);white-space:nowrap}.NewsletterForm_inlineInputRow__j87R2{display:flex;gap:8px;position:relative}.NewsletterForm_inlineInputRow__j87R2 .NewsletterForm_input__kbLPR{width:220px}.NewsletterForm_cardForm___qlKP{position:relative}.NewsletterForm_cardHeading__Oxj2d{font-family:var(--font-display);font-size:20px;font-weight:400;letter-spacing:-.01em;color:var(--text-primary);margin:0 0 6px}.NewsletterForm_cardSub__XySH3{font-size:14px;color:var(--text-secondary);line-height:1.5;margin:0 0 16px}.NewsletterForm_cardInputRow__XHtdQ{display:flex;gap:10px;position:relative}.NewsletterForm_cardInputRow__XHtdQ .NewsletterForm_input__kbLPR{flex:1 1}.NewsletterForm_cardDisclaimer__Kvb1k{margin:8px 0 0;font-size:12px;color:var(--text-tertiary)}@media (max-width:700px){.NewsletterForm_inlineForm__C89SW{flex-direction:column;align-items:flex-start;gap:10px}.NewsletterForm_inlineInputRow__j87R2{width:100%}.NewsletterForm_inlineInputRow__j87R2 .NewsletterForm_input__kbLPR{width:auto;flex:1 1}.NewsletterForm_cardInputRow__XHtdQ{flex-direction:column}}.SideRail_rail__PUj2P{position:fixed;top:0;left:0;bottom:0;width:var(--rail-w);z-index:200;background:var(--bg-0);border-right:1px solid var(--bdr);display:flex;flex-direction:column;align-items:center;padding:20px 0}.SideRail_logo__RYkjt{font-family:var(--font-display);font-weight:800;font-size:16px;color:var(--tx-0);writing-mode:vertical-rl;-webkit-text-orientation:mixed;text-orientation:mixed;transform:rotate(180deg);letter-spacing:1px;margin-bottom:auto;text-decoration:none}.SideRail_dots__dYCpf{display:flex;flex-direction:column;gap:6px;margin-bottom:auto;margin-top:auto}.SideRail_dot__ZGnaJ{width:6px;height:6px;border-radius:50%;background:var(--tx-4);transition:all .3s}.SideRail_dot__ZGnaJ.SideRail_active__Socqc{background:var(--cyan);box-shadow:0 0 8px rgba(0,229,255,.4)}.SideRail_year__ccApY{font-family:var(--font-mono);font-size:9px;color:var(--tx-4);writing-mode:vertical-rl;-webkit-text-orientation:mixed;text-orientation:mixed;transform:rotate(180deg);letter-spacing:2px;text-transform:uppercase}@media (max-width:1024px){.SideRail_rail__PUj2P{display:none}}